Bacon Wrapped Cod Ingredients
4 cod fillets
4 slices of thick cut bacon
Salt & Pepper
2 tablespoons butter, melted or olive oil
Bacon Wrapped Cod Directions
-
Preheat oven
Preheat oven to 400°F.
-
Prepare cod fish
Lay out the cod fillet on a clean cutting board and pat dry with a paper towel.
-
Brush with butter
Brush melted butter or olive oil all over each piece of cod.

Quick Tip
For a dairy free option, use olive oil instead of butter. -
Season
Season with salt and pepper.
-
Bacon wrap
Wrap each fillet with one slice of bacon.
-
Bake it
Place each bacon wrapped fillet on a parchment or foil lined baking tray. Bake at 400°F for 10 to 12 minutes or until fish is cooked through and flaky.
